About This Book

In Santa Fe, New Mexico, Clint meets a beautiful artist, who asks if she can paint his portrait. He agrees, and they begin to work together, but no sex occurs between the two. However, the woman's husband—a prominent lawyer and would-be politician, who is also an abusive husband—doesn't believe this. When he is found dead, murdered, in his wife's studio, everyone in town assumes Clint Adams did it. It falls to the Gunsmith to prove otherwise.
